GENERAL INFORMATION

In Vietnam, the fishery sector plays an important role in the national economy, accounting for about 4-5 percent of Gross Domestic Product (GDP) and about 9-10% of national export revenue.

More than 4 millions of people working in the fishery and the growth in production have attributed to the fish exports. Thanks to strongly increase in many years, Vietnam ranks among the top ten seafood suppliers and its seafood products are exported to 170 markets in the world.

Shrimp, pangasius, tuna, squid and octopus are main seafood products exported by the country. In which, shrimp exports create about US$ 3.5 – 4 billion, make up 46-50% of the total seafood sales of Vietnam. Earnings from pangasius reached at US$ 1.7 – 1.8 billion (25% of the total) and exports from Tuna and Cephalopods are US$ 450 – 550 million for each.

Exports to the U.S, Japan, EU, China and South Korea make up 75% of Vietnam’s seafood sales to the wolrd.

5 advantages for Vietnam seafood exports:  

(1)  High commitment and participation from Government, Industry and companies for food safety, environment  and social responsibility;

(2)  Able to supply the big volume and safe quality and stable seafood products;

(3)  Meet all the customers’ requirements, incl. the vertical linkage (integration) for each species sector;

(4)  Vietnam is one in few countries in the world which has the good and stable labor resource; 

(5)  Vietnam has Agreements / FTAs with many countries and territories and has advantages both in product quality and im-ex tax.  

Pangasius enterprises show their interests in processing

(vasep.com.vn) Many pangasius enterprises are investing in processing to create products with higher values such as cooking oil, collagen and gelatin to expand the market and reduce dependence on exports.

 According Vietnam Pangasius Associationpangasius fillets was accounted for over 80% of pangasius exported products,whole fish or cut fish products made up 10% and value added products took up only 5%.

Annual production of fat from pangasius in Mekong Delta is at least 140,000 MT. This is used for feeds, biodiesel or exported at low prices. Meanwhile the demand for biodiesel is growing in Vietnam. Ranee fish oil plant, invested by  Sao Mai Groupis projected to produce at 100 MT/ day then upgrade to 200 MT/ day and achieve 300 MT/day after 2016, using this oil.

Vinh Hoan Corporation, on its completion of its 2,000 MT /year collagen and gelatin factory in Cao Lanh district of  Dong Thap province expected to launch the new products in the beginning of 2015.
